Jim Cramer identified Nvidia as a major beneficiary of Dell Technologies’ recently released quarterly results, which significantly exceeded market expectations. He emphasized that Dell’s strong performance in AI server sales reflects robust demand for Nvidia’s processors. The remarks came during the CNBC Investing Club’s “Morning Meeting” and underscore the growing influence of AI hardware investments on the broader technology landscape.

On a recent episode of CNBC’s “Morning Meeting,” Jim Cramer weighed in on Dell Technologies’ latest quarterly report, describing it as a “monster quarter.” Dell’s earnings surpassed analyst estimates, driven largely by surging sales of artificial intelligence servers. Cramer highlighted Nvidia as a clear winner from this development, noting that Dell is a key original equipment manufacturer (OEM) that integrates Nvidia’s graphics processing units (GPUs) into its high-performance computing and AI server systems. He argued that the strong demand for Dell’s AI infrastructure directly translates into increased orders for Nvidia’s chips, reinforcing the chipmaker’s dominant position in the AI semiconductor market. Cramer further explained that Dell’s results may serve as a bellwether for the entire AI supply chain. As more enterprises deploy AI workloads, hardware makers like Dell are likely to experience sustained demand, which in turn supports Nvidia’s revenue growth. The commentary comes amid a period of heightened investor focus on AI-related companies, with Nvidia already enjoying substantial market capitalization gains over the past year. Cramer cautioned, however, that investors should monitor the pace of AI adoption and potential competitive pressures from other chip designers.

Key takeaways from Cramer’s analysis include the reinforcing relationship between major hardware vendors and semiconductor suppliers in the AI ecosystem. Dell’s earnings report, which was released in the most recent quarter, featured strong year-over-year growth in its Infrastructure Solutions Group—a segment that heavily relies on Nvidia’s GPUs. This suggests that enterprise AI spending continues to accelerate, benefiting companies that provide the foundational hardware for AI training and inference. Moreover, Cramer’s confidence in Nvidia’s outlook was based partly on Dell’s commentary about a robust pipeline of AI projects. If this pipeline materializes, Nvidia could see extended growth beyond the current volatile market environment. However, the comments also imply that any slowdown in Dell’s AI server sales would likely affect Nvidia’s performance. Investors may view Dell’s results as an indirect indicator of Nvidia’s near-term demand trends. The broader implication is that the AI infrastructure buildout remains a strong tailwind for select tech companies, but it is not immune to macroeconomic factors or supply chain disruptions.

From an investment perspective, Cramer’s remarks highlight the interconnected nature of the AI hardware supply chain. While Nvidia appears well‑positioned to benefit from Dell’s success, potential risks include increased competition from custom chips designed by hyperscalers and fluctuating enterprise budgets. The semiconductor industry is also subject to cyclical demand patterns, which could moderate Nvidia’s growth trajectory over the medium term. Investors considering Nvidia should weigh its current valuation against the possibility that AI demand growth could decelerate as the technology matures. Cramer’s analysis does not recommend specific price targets or trading actions, but suggests that Nvidia remains a core holding for those bullish on AI infrastructure. Broader market expectations indicate that AI-related capital expenditure may remain elevated in the coming quarters, providing continued support for companies like Nvidia and its OEM partners.
